MySQL是一種開源的關系型數據庫管理系統,常用于Web應用程序的開發和數據存儲。在實際的項目中,我們需要對MySQL進行配置以滿足項目的需求。
以下是MySQL數據庫配置項目的具體內容:
# 1. 配置MySQL服務端口 [mysqld] port = 3306 # 2. 設置MySQL數據文件和日志文件目錄 [mysqld] datadir=/var/lib/mysql log-bin=/var/log/mysql/mysql-bin.log # 3. 配置字符集和排序方式 [client] default-character-set=utf8 [mysql] default-character-set=utf8 [mysqld] character-set-server = utf8 collation-server = utf8_general_ci # 4. 配置MySQL用戶認證方式 [client] default-authentication-plugin=mysql_native_password [mysqld] default-authentication-plugin=mysql_native_password # 5. 配置MySQL備份和恢復 [mysqldump] quick max_allowed_packet = 512M [mysql] quick max_allowed_packet = 512M # 6. 配置MySQL日志 [mysqld] log_output=FILE general_log_file=/var/log/mysql/mysql.log general_log=1 # 7. 配置MySQL緩存 [mysqld] query_cache_limit=2M query_cache_size=64M query_cache_type=1 # 8. 配置MySQL連接數和并發線程數 [mysqld] max_connections=200 max_user_connections=100 thread_concurrency=8 # 9. 配置MySQL參數 [mysqld] max_allowed_packet=32M innodb_buffer_pool_size=1G innodb_log_file_size=256M innodb_log_buffer_size=16M
以上是MySQL數據庫配置項目的主要內容,根據項目需求進行相應配置可以提高MySQL的性能和安全性。